Netflix, the inarguably TV show giant, is all set to amaze subscribers with another season of American dark fantasy/adventure web series Dark Crystal Age of Resistance. The first season was produced by Netflix and The Jim Henson Company, 37 years after Jim Henson’s movie. It was consist of 10 episodes that were received by fans and critics.

Dark Crystal Age of Resistance Season 2; Expectations
A very little amount of spoilers!
Gelflings and Skesis were the two prominent powers. Although Geflings won the battle of Stones in wood, the war was not over against Skesis. Till the very end of the first season – despite the hard work – scientists were unable to invent a weapon that will turn the war in Skesis’ favor. The result of the corpses of Arathim and the Gruneks pieced together – Garthim – were powered by the dark crystal. This could be the tool to win the war for Skesis.
